Fleet Legislative Summit

September 20, 2022 - September 21, 2022

  • « National Drive Electric Week: Electric Vehicle Fall Festival
  • National Drive Electric Week Event at Pembroke Mall »

NAFA Chapters – NAFA

September 20-21, 2022 | Arlington, VA
The Westin Arlington Gateway

Fleet professionals from across the US will gather in the Nation’s Capital for two days of education and conversations on issues impacting the fleet and mobility industry, advocacy training, and networking. The industry’s leading experts will cover a multitude of legislative and regulatory topics affecting the industry, including a specific focus on:

  • The Preventing Auto Recycling Thefts (PART) Act,
  • EV Recharging Infrastructure, and
  • Vehicular Data Access and how it relates to fleet operations.

After a day of programming on the key legislative and regulatory issues facing our industry, attendees will have the opportunity to discuss with their congressional representative in Washington, D.C., the issues that matter most to the fleet industry. In addition, NAFA will host a congressional staff briefing on the challenges and opportunities of fleet electrification.
